- Expanded Product Range: With multiple vendors, you can offer a far wider range of products than you could alone. This attracts more customers and keeps them coming back for more.
- Increased Traffic & Sales: More products mean more visibility. Each vendor brings their own customer base, driving more traffic to your site and boosting overall sales.
- Reduced Inventory Management: Vendors handle their own inventory, freeing you from the headaches of managing a massive product catalog.
- Commission-Based Revenue: Instead of directly selling products, you earn a commission on each sale made by your vendors. This can be a very profitable business model.
- Scalability: A multi-vendor marketplace is inherently more scalable than a single-vendor store. As you add more vendors, your marketplace grows organically.

- Features: What features do you absolutely need? Make a list of your must-haves and nice-to-haves. Do you need advanced commission options? Live chat? Vendor subscriptions? Make sure the plugin you choose offers the features you need.
- Ease of Use: How comfortable are you with technical stuff? Some plugins are more complex than others. If you're a beginner, opt for a plugin that's easy to set up and use.
- Scalability: How big do you plan to grow your marketplace? Choose a plugin that can handle a large number of vendors and products without slowing down your site.
- Budget: How much are you willing to spend? Multi-vendor plugins range in price from free to several hundred dollars per year. Consider your budget and choose a plugin that offers the best value for your money.
- Support: Does the plugin developer offer good customer support? Check reviews and forums to see what other users have to say about the support quality.

1. Dokan
Dokan is arguably the most popular WooCommerce multi-vendor plugin, and for good reason. It's packed with features and offers a robust platform for building a full-fledged marketplace. Dokan stands out with its intuitive vendor dashboard, which allows sellers to easily manage their products, orders, and profiles. The frontend product submission feature simplifies the process for vendors, making it easy for them to add and update their listings without navigating the backend of WordPress.

2. WC Marketplace
WC Marketplace is another powerful WooCommerce multi-vendor plugin that offers a wide range of features. It's a solid alternative to Dokan, with a strong focus on flexibility and customization. WC Marketplace allows vendors to create their own stores, manage products, and handle shipping, all from a user-friendly interface. One of the standout features of WC Marketplace is its comprehensive commission system, which allows you to set different commission rates for different vendors or product categories.

3. WCFM Marketplace
WCFM Marketplace (WooCommerce Frontend Manager) is a comprehensive multi-vendor plugin that aims to provide a complete frontend management solution for your marketplace. It boasts an impressive array of features, allowing vendors to manage almost every aspect of their store from the frontend. WCFM Marketplace is known for its advanced features, such as live chat, vendor subscriptions, and product inquiry systems.

4. Product Vendors
Product Vendors is a WooCommerce extension developed by WooCommerce themselves. It's a simpler and more straightforward option compared to Dokan, WC Marketplace, and WCFM Marketplace. Product Vendors focuses on providing the essential features for managing a multi-vendor marketplace, without overwhelming you with too many options. It's a great choice if you want a simple and reliable solution without a steep learning curve. It integrates seamlessly with WooCommerce and offers a streamlined approach to managing vendors and their products.
